Job description

Job Title: Senior Staff Nurse Haematology

Band: Band 6

Location: Birmingham

Salary: Competitive Shift Enhancements

Hours of work: Permanent full-time position (37.5 hours per week)

Our client is seeking a dedicated Senior Staff Nurse to join their expert Cancer Nursing Team in Birmingham. This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ced Band 6 Nurse or a Band 5 Nurse with consolidated haematology cancer nursing experience to take the next step in their career. Haematology experience is essential and you must be a SACT‑approved chemotherapy giver.

Key Duties & Responsibilities
  • Work within a highly skilled haematology nursing team providing specialist cancer care
  • Deliver assess and evaluate personalised treatment plans
  • Be an advocate for patients and their families supporting them medically, physically and emotionally throughout their cancer journey
  • Gain greater autonomy; our nurse‑led clinical model means you’ll play a key role in assessment and treatment decisions
Qualifications & Experience Required
  • A current NMC Nurse registration
  • Experience in chemotherapy administration
  • Post registration experience within a haematology setting is essential
